LEXINGTON, Ky. (ABC36 NEWS NOW) – There were plenty 4th of July activities today here in Lexington, from the “10k and fun run” Thursday morning to the festival and the parade on Main Street. “This is an awesome experience for everybody to be here all together celebrating,” said attendee Karsyn. The city of Lexington holding several events during the days leading up to the 4th of July, along with several festivities on Thursday. Including a festival and market and the parade. “It’s always a good time,” said attendee Tina Payne. “We love to come downtown, celebrate and have a good time. You know we get to see family and friends while we’re here, so that’s always great.” Hundreds of people came out for the events. Some sharing the experience with their family. “We’re just coming out to have a good time with our family and just be able to spend time with each other,” said Ashley McKee. Her and her husband brought their daughter with them to the parade. “This is her second 4th of July parade and she’s loving all the firetrucks, first responders and all the lights and sirens,” said Austin McKee. But the fun didn’t stop there. The fireworks show began at 10 p.m. downtown. “They are kind of shot up around Manchester, Oliver Lewis Way and Leestown road area,” said Paul Hooper with . “So, you kind of want to get in that general vicinity but there are big fireworks. So if you get somewhat close to there you’ll probably be able to see them really well.” Other cities also celebrated independence day. In Frankfort there was a celebration from five to nine p.m. featuring live music and games, with the fireworks show to afterwards. In Richmond, there was live music, vendors, food truck and inflatables, as well as a fireworks show beginning at 10.
